15. Largest economy in SEA
Cut the poverty rate by more than half since 1999 to under 10% before
the COVID - 19 pandemic
Assumed G20 presidency in 2022; encourages cooperation between
countries to achieve stronger and sustainable recovery from the
pandemic
Currently in the final phase of their development plan; RPJMN(Rencana
Pembangunan Jangka Menengah Nasional) this phase aims for improving
the human capital and competitiveness in the global market
Economy
16. Present conditions, problems
The poverty rate partially increased due to the pandemic
Went from upper middle class to lower middle-class income in 2021
The pandemic closing down the schools will have repercussions for
futurenext generations
17. Solutions of the country
Indonesia’s COVID-19 response involves free vaccination program, social
assistance, healthcare systems and strengthening of the financial sector
Program Keluarga Harapan - Program to reduce poverty by providing
beneficiaries with financial assistance, education in regards to family
development, health, nutrition, child protection and finances.
Reduced stunting rate from 37% in 2014 to 24.4% in 2021, programs like
INEY (Investing in Nutrition and Early years program) program
Currently in a new Country Partnership Framework with the world bank
with its priorities aligned with the RPJMN; sustainable recovery from the
pandemic and long-term economic growth.
18. Synthesis
Indonesia, the world's largest archipelago, is a diverse and captivating nation
located in Southeast Asia. With its unique blend of cultures, breathtaking natural
beauty, and rich history, Indonesia is a remarkable synthesis of tradition and
modernity. Though predominantly Muslim, the numerous cultures in the nation
make everything from language, food, tourist spots, and much more being the
most diverse in all of Southeast Asia. Certain traditions and practices can be seen
in Indonesia like Nyepi and Ma’Nene, showing the country’s shared beliefs even
with different backgrounds. The country being the largest and most numerous in
Southeast Asia not only in size, population, culture, and nature. Indonesia also
has the largest economy by far and continuously uses those funds to further
support its people. Through numerous development programs that combat
poverty, whether be it financial through financial or educational means. Even
with the advent of the COVID-19 pandemic, the country and its economy have
shown resilience with its response through free vaccination, and financial and
healthcare assistance.
